Patrick Butter ( – ) was an officer in the Royal Navy.
Life & Career
Butter was appointed in command of the destroyer Ulster on 17 January, 1919.[1]
On 28 November, 1919, Butter was appointed in command of the destroyer Tyrian.[2]
